AW-Energy first wave energy company to sign a EUR 3 million contract with the ne...

AW-Energy Ltd, a Finnish cleantech company that is developing a unique and patented wave energy technology under the brand name of WaveRoller, has signed a EUR 3 million contract with The European Union to demonstrate its technology. The global ocean energy resources are enormous. Ocean energy technology represents the largest untapped business potential within the renewables sector.
